Type: LanguageService
Describe the bug
- OS and Version: Linux x64 5.8.7-dirty
- VS Code Version: 1.53.0-insider (9b6aaf1e86c8fec4c86c664edf5f713583c70fe5)
- C/C++ Extension Version: v1.1.3
- Other extensions you installed (and if the issue persists after disabling them): Only C/C++ extension is enabled.
- Does this issue involve using SSH remote to run the extension on a remote machine?: N/A
- A clear and concise description of what the bug is, including information about the workspace (i.e. is the workspace a single project or multiple projects, size of the project, etc).: "Tasks: Configure Default Build Task" always lists the top-most project as the "active file" for generating a new task.
Steps to reproduce
- Create a workspace
- Add multiple root workspace projects
- Make one of the projects NOT contain a "tasks.json" file, but do NOT make that project the top/first project. (not really necessary, but highlights the issue)
- Tasks: Configure Default Build Task
- Close the workspace and only open the project WITHOUT a "tasks.json" file.
- Tasks: Configure Default Build Task
Expected behavior
I'd expect step 4 to show the project that doesn't have a "tasks.json" file like it does in step 6, as opposed to showing the top root workspace project for task generation (screenshots should make it clear).
Logs
N/A (nothing showing relating to the "Configure Default Build Task" when activated)
Screenshots
Multi-root incorrect:

It looks to always be the top-most project that gets the "generate" option for tasks. It seems to always consider it the "active file".
Even when I open the "app.cpp" for the "firmware" project which already has a "tasks.json" file, it still considers the top Arduino project as the "active file".
